It costs lots of money to run a zoo. And unfortunately, due to the pandemic, most of them around the US were closed to the public. To help infuse some cash into the Detroit Zoo, Brad Paisley and a few friends are throwing a virtual concert.
Half of the $30 ticket price for “All Together for Animals” will go right to the Detroit Zoological Society, as well as any contributions above that. The show takes place from another zoo, Nashville Zoo, plus the Steel Mill Studios, on Wednesday.
